Jennifer Garner and John Miller are still going strong despite reports that Ben Affleck is eyeing a reconciliation his ex-wife amid Jennifer Lopez divorce.

Affleck, who was married to Garner for 13 years and share three children together, was leaning on the Alias star for support as he navigated his marital problems with Lopez.

Meanwhile, reports of conflict between Garner and her boyfriend John Miller emerged, sparking rumours of a possible split between the two.

The reports suggested that Miller was not happy about the growing friendship between Garner and Affleck.

A source informed Daily Mail that Miller and Garner had been experiencing a “divide” because of Garner’s friendship with Affleck as she was supporting him during a tough time.

The source added that “John doesn’t like sharing Jen” and is concerned with how much time Garner has put into the Bennifer split, implying that Miller cannot help feeling insecure of his girlfriend’s ex.

However, the couple appeared happy as they enjoyed a dinner date on Friday, August 23. The 46-year-old businessman and 52-year-old actress were seen laughing, walking towards their car, in LA.

Amid rumours about their possible split, the same source confirmed that the Elektra actress and Miller have not broken up and that their friends and family are sure their “they will be together for a long time.”

The Bennifer divorce might have affected their relationship but the source remarked that both Garner and Miller “want to be in a better place, but some work needs to be done.” And that it is admittedly going to take a little time.

One Direction fans were hit with a wave of nostalgia when Harry Styles made a surprise appearance at Niall Horan’s concert earlier this week.

On Tuesday, August 27, Styles, 30, was spotted in the crowd during his former One Direction bandmate’s The Show Live on Tour, jamming along as his former bandmate performed Stockholm Syndrome—a hit from One Direction’s 2014 album, Four.

In a fan-captured video circulating on social media, the As It Was hitmaker could be seen enjoying the performance at Co-op Live in Manchester, dressed casually in a yellow cardigan and white T-shirt, with a crossbody bag and some facial hair completing his laid-back look.

At one point, he even waves his arms to the rhythm of the song, clearly caught up in the nostalgia of the moment.

Four was the last album to feature all five original members of One Direction before Zayn Malik’s departure in 2015, making this moment even more special for fans of the iconic boy band.

Horan, who released his third solo album The Show last year, is currently on tour with upcoming stops in Scotland, London, and Mexico City. The tour has already seen guest appearances from major artists like Ed Sheeran, who joined Horan on stage in Dublin.

Meanwhile, Styles has been keeping a low profile after a whirlwind few years, including the release of his album Harry’s House and starring roles in Don’t Worry Darling and My Policeman.
